Section 3. Civil Provisions of General Application

Art. 1303.1. Proceedings under Chapter

A. Except as otherwise provided by this Chapter, this Section applies to all proceedings under this Chapter.

B. This Chapter provides for the following proceedings:

(1) Establishment of an order for spousal support or child support pursuant to Section 4 of this Chapter.

(2) Enforcement of a support order and income-withholding order of another state without registration pursuant to Section 5 of this Chapter.

(3) Registration of an order for spousal support or child support of another state for enforcement pursuant to Section 7 of this Chapter.

(4) Modification of an order for child support or spousal support issued by a tribunal of this state pursuant to Subsection B of Section 2 of this Chapter.

(5) Registration of an order for child support for another state for modification pursuant to Section 6 of this Chapter.

(6) Determination of parentage pursuant to Section 7 of this Chapter.

(7) Assertion of jurisdiction over nonresidents pursuant to Subsection A of Section 2 of this Chapter.

C. An individual petitioner or a support enforcement agency may commence a proceeding authorized under this Chapter by filing a petition in an initiating tribunal for forwarding to a responding tribunal or by filing a petition or a comparable pleading directly in a tribunal of another state which has or can obtain personal jurisdiction over the respondent.

Acts 1995, No. 251, §1, eff. Jan. 1, 1996; Acts 1997, No. 1241, §1, eff. July 15, 1997.
